Statesboro Police Incidents
RUDE RUDYS – A male was causing a disturbance in the parking lot. He was advised to leave the scene, but refuse, and was arrested.
FAIR ROAD – A man was stopped for an expired tag when it was discovered that he had a failure to appear warrant and was arrested.
STATESBORO PLACE – Someone kicked the front door of a persons apartment causing damage to the door. Two days later another person kicked the door, causing even more damage.
MCDONALDS – A man was found asleep in the drive through at McDonalds. He was found to be intoxicated above the legal limit and had a controlled substance in his possession.
STATESBORO PLACE APARTMENTS – The fire department responded to a dumpster fire at the complex.
EAGLE COURT – A woman said the father of her children had been drinking and started a physical altercation. He reportedly was asked to leave then got angry, grabbed the woman by the neck and threw her across the room, damaging some furniture. He was not on scene when officers arrived.
